四星電子藍牙串口適配器與筆記本電腦內置藍牙的通信
添加時間:2009-10-15 11:47:03 點擊次數:20093

德陽四星電子技術有限公司(2009/10/14)

    四星電子的藍牙串口產品,如FS-BT485A、FS-BT-PPI、FS-BT-MPI,在設計上充分考慮了與其它藍牙產品的兼容性,可以與筆記本電腦的內置藍牙、掌上電腦的內置藍牙、市售的USB藍牙適配器等標準藍牙產品進行串口無線通信。

    使用方法是:將四星電子藍牙串口如FS-BT485A設置成從設備(對于FS-BT-PPI、FS-BT-MPI,安裝在PLC上的那個模塊本身即是從設備),由電腦等標準藍牙發起配對鏈接,建立串口通信鏈路,實現電腦到設備串口的透明藍牙無線通信。

    采用這種方案時,藍牙無線通信距離主要受筆記本電腦內置藍牙通信距離(一般為Class2功率等級,傳輸距離為10米)的限制,但往往大于該標稱距離,這是因為四星電子的藍牙具有較大功率等級的緣故。

    使用前需對四星電子藍牙串口適配器如FS-BT485A進行如下設置:從設備、設備名稱=用戶自定義的設備名稱如FS-BT485A等、PIN碼=用戶自定義的密碼、波特率=設備串口的波特率、校驗位=設備串口的校驗位、停止位=設備串口的停止位。這里需要說明的是,所有藍牙串口都是固定的8個數據位,不支持其它如5、7、9數據位。

    關于四星電子藍牙串口適配器的設置請看對應產品的使用手冊和BT232Set藍牙設置軟件使用說明。

一、筆記本電腦內置藍牙與四星電子藍牙串口適配器的通信

    以惠普筆記本電腦為例,使用藍牙時請確認筆記本電腦側面的藍牙開關已經打開,并且在電腦的設備管理器中應該能看到類似下圖紅線框中所示的藍牙設備,說明藍牙工作正常。

    將已設置成從設備的四星電子藍牙串口適配器如FS-BT485A接通電源并置于筆記本電腦的藍牙信號覆蓋范圍內。

1、鼠標指向屏幕右下角的藍牙圖標單擊右鍵->點擊“添加藍牙設備”。

2、屏幕顯示藍牙設置向導,點擊“下一步”。

3、搜索藍牙設備,數秒鐘后將搜索到并顯示筆記本電腦周圍的藍牙設備,選中四星電子藍牙串口適配器FS-BT485A,點擊“下一步”。

4、輸入FS-BT485A的安全代碼,然后點擊“立即配對”。該安全代碼也稱密碼、PIN碼,是用戶在設置FS-BT485A時為其設置的PIN碼,可用BT232Set藍牙設置軟件查看,出廠默認設置為:00000000。

5、勾選“SPP Server”,點擊“下一步”。

6、點擊“完成”,結束藍牙設置向導。

    下面的屏幕彈出窗口顯示筆記本電腦的藍牙串口COM6已經與FS-BT485A建立連接,在你的應用程序中使用COM6與FS-BT485A相連的設備通信即可,就像使用電纜與設備通信一樣。

 

 

二、市售USB藍牙適配器與四星電子藍牙串口適配器的通信

1、 將USB藍牙適配器插入電腦的USB口并安裝相應的驅動程序,對于內置藍牙,也許不需要安裝驅動程序。安裝驅動后,查看WINDOWS的設備管理器中會顯示藍牙設備,如下圖所示:

2、 安裝IVT BlueSoleil 1.6之類的藍牙應用軟件。插入隨USB藍牙適配器提供的光盤,按提示安裝完IVT BlueSoleil 1.6應用軟件并啟動該程序主窗口。

3、將已設置成從設備的四星電子藍牙串口適配器如FS-BT485A接通電源并置于藍牙信號覆蓋范圍內。在主菜單“我的藍牙”菜單中點擊“搜索藍牙設備”,幾秒鐘后將會尋找到四星電子藍牙串口適配器,如下圖中的設備名稱FS-BT485A。

4、選中FS-BT485A并單擊鼠標右鍵,點擊“配對”。

5、按提示輸入藍牙口令,該口令即是四星電子藍牙串口適配器的PIN碼,是在設置藍牙串口適配器時由用戶設置的,默認值為:00000000。

6、選中FS-BT485A并單擊鼠標右鍵,點擊“刷新服務”自動找到藍牙串行端口服務。點擊“連接->藍牙串行端口服務”,發起與四星電子藍牙串口適配器的連接。

7、與四星電子藍牙串口適配器連接成功后的主窗口顯示如下,并且在屏幕的右下角顯示有與遠程設備相連接的串口號(如下圖中顯示COM15),這時四星電子藍牙串口適配器上的藍色指示燈Link變為常亮,表示電腦的COM15串口與連接FS-BT485A的設備串口之間建立了透明鏈接,就像用電纜直接連接一樣。

8、接下來就可以在你的應用軟件中使用COM15號串口與設備進行藍牙無線通信了。

 

幾點說明:

   ●有些應用程序支持的串口數量是有限的,如西門子PLC的編程軟件STEP7和STEP7 Micro/WIN使用的串口號不能超過COM8(COM8以上的雖然能顯示并選擇,但已不能使用),這時你需要在WINDOWS的設備管理器中將COM15強制改變成COM8以下的串口號。但下次連接時需改回原來的串口號,否則無法建立連接!

   ●對于連接不同的設備需要正確地設置四星電子藍牙串口適配器的通信參數,如:

   ●對于連接西門子S7-200PLC,串口參數為:波特率9600;偶校驗;1個停止位,并在STEP7 Micro/WIN軟件“設置PG/PC接口”的本地連接設置中勾選“調制解調器連接”。

   ●對于連接西門子S7-300/400PLC,串口參數為:波特率19200;奇校驗;1個停止位,并使用PC Adapter連接FS-BT485A與S7-300/400PLC。

   ●由于藍牙串口適配器不支持7個數據位,所以三菱FX系列PLC(串口數據位為7個數據位)不能使用藍牙串口適配器與電腦的內置藍牙或市售USB藍牙適配器進行通信,只能成對使用FS-BT485A或FS-BT-SC09來實現電腦與三菱FX系列PLC之間串口到串口的無線通信。

 

奇米777在线